Adnan Sami calls Pakistan an 'ex-lover' amid debate over his citizenship: 'Can't see me moving on with India'

Adnan Sami
has finally addressed the ongoing chatter around his Indian citizenship, saying the backlash feels like an 'ex-lover' who can't accept him moving on. While his music continues to win hearts, Sami believes it's time the focus shifts from his nationality to his decades-long contribution to music.
In an interview with Bollywood Bubble, Adnan spoke about his citizenship often overshadowing his musical contributions. He likened the situation to that of an ex-lover struggling to move on. He explained that the backlash he receives stems more from lingering emotions than genuine criticism—suggesting that beneath the negativity lies unresolved affection and a reluctance to let go. Sami said he understands the psyche behind such reactions, even if they manifest in strange or emotional ways.
The singer further pointed out that many people are unaware of the circumstances that led to his decision, and it's unfair for anyone to assume they understand his reasons. He emphasized that his choice was based on solid, personal grounds. Addressing the backlash, he questioned why global migration is widely accepted, yet his move draws criticism—highlighting the ongoing geopolitical tension between India and
Pakistan
.

Ultimately, he reiterated that much of the negativity stems from what he described as an 'ex-lover syndrome,' a lingering emotional reaction rather than a rational one.
He also reflected on the lack of recognition he received from the Pakistani government throughout his decades-long music career. Despite contributing to the industry for nearly 40 years, he said he was never honoured or awarded by the authorities there—a disappointment that was only a small part of the challenges he faced.
However, he clarified that his issues were never with the people of Pakistan. On the contrary, he expressed deep affection and gratitude for his audience, who he said have always showered him with love and continue to do so.
Adnan further clarified that his discontent was directed solely at the government, not the people of Pakistan. He emphasised that the general public has always shown him immense love, and he continues to feel a deep connection with them.
As an artist, he believes in reciprocating love equally and holds no bitterness toward anyone. While some may develop resentment over his choices, he views even that as stemming from a place of love.
He expressed hope that, with time, these feelings would heal. His music, he stressed, is for everyone—without borders or conditions—and he welcomes all who wish to engage with it.
His citizenship became a widely discussed topic after he was granted Indian citizenship by the Government of India, effective January 1, 2016. Born in the UK to Pakistani parents, Sami had held Pakistani citizenship until then. His request for Indian citizenship, made in 2015, was approved on humanitarian grounds. However, the move sparked considerable debate, with critics raising questions about the reasons behind the decision—particularly in light of his Pakistani origins and the complex political dynamics between the two countries.

Jackie Shroff lends support to Hetal Dave's biopic 'Sumo Didi'

Actor Jackie Shroff has extended his support to the upcoming biopic on India's first female sumo wrestler, Hetal Dave named "Sumo Didi". Shroff proudly shared that Dave has been ranked as the 5th biggest female wrestler in the world. Taking to his X timeline, he penned a note, urging all to lend their support to "Sumo Didi". His post read, "Do you know we have a Sumo Wrestler in our country?.. Hetal Dave india's first female sumo wrestler.. Ranked 5th in the world... Comes in the most popular female Sumo Wrestlers of the World.. but not known in INDIA.. She also has a Biopic on her Name "SUMODIDI" which will release very soon.. Follow and support her so that the World Knows "HAI SARE JAHAN PE BHAARI, MERE BHARAT KI BETI. (sic)" Made under the direction of Jayant Rohatgi, "Sumo Didi" also marks his directorial debut. With Shriyam Bhagnani essaying the role of Hetal Dave, the biographical drama further stars Chaitnya Sharma, Anubha Fatehpura, Nitesh Pandey, and Raghav Dheer in significant roles, along with others. The drama chronicles Dave's journey of discovering sumo wrestling by chance. While she poured her blood and sweat to make her dreams a reality, she was forced to deal with social prejudices and patriarchal mindsets. The technical crew of the film has on board Akash Agrawal as the cinematographer, Dev Rao Jadhav as the editor, and Amar Mangrulkar as the music composer.

'Kuberaa' box office collection day 3 (LIVE): Dhanush starrer conquers the box office with growing popularity

Directed by Sekhar Kamulla, the film 'Kubera' starring Dhanush, Nagarjuna, and Rashmika Mandanna in the lead roles was released to a grand audience in Telugu, Tamil, Kannada, and Hindi last Friday (June 20). Released amidst high expectations from fans and critics, the film tells a story centered on desires, power, and greed. Produced on a massive budget, the film has made a huge impact in multiple languages. Impressive day 1 and day 2 collections 'Kuberaa' collected Rs 14.75 crore in India on its first day, as per Sacnilk. Of this, the Telugu version got Rs.10 crore, the Tamil version got Rs.4.5 crore, the Kannada version got Rs.0.02 crore, and the Hindi version got Rs.0.23 crore. The second day's collection rose to Rs 17.61 crore, of which Telugu earned Rs 12.77 crore, Tamil Rs 4.5 crore, and Hindi Rs 0.34 crore. This also shows a growth of 19.39% compared to the first day. Steady day 3 earnings and high theater occupancy 'Kuberaa' added Rs 4.67 crore on its third day, taking its total collection to Rs 37.2 crore. ‘Jana Nayagan Does Justice To Vijay's Legacy,' Says Producer On Thalapathy's Final Film

Last Updated: Thalapathy Vijay's final film Jana Nayagan is not just a farewell but a tribute to his legendary career, says producer Venkat K. Narayana. Thalapathy Vijay turned 51 on June 22, and to mark the special occasion, the makers of his final film Jana Nayagan unveiled the much-anticipated first glimpse titled 'The First Roar." The sneak peek, which dropped at midnight, has set the internet ablaze, offering fans a fiery glimpse of Vijay in a fierce police avatar — complete with a twirled moustache and blazing eyes, standing tall amidst riotous chaos. The film is slated to release on January 9, 2026, and expectations are already sky-high. Produced by Venkat K. Narayana under KVN Productions and directed by H. Vinoth, Jana Nayagan marks a pivotal moment in Indian cinema — the farewell of a superstar whose legacy has transcended generations. In an official statement, producer Venkat K. Narayana expressed the emotional weight behind working on Vijay's final film. He said, 'Working with Thalapathy Vijay on his final film is not just a professional milestone — it's a deeply personal honour. As fans ourselves, we know how much this film means to millions across the world. The 'First Roar' is just a glimpse into the cinematic and emotional scale of what we're building." He further added, 'We're crafting a film that does justice to Thalapathy's extraordinary journey. Jana Nayagan is not just a farewell, but it's a celebration of an icon who changed the face of Indian cinema." The short teaser video makes it clear that Jana Nayagan will be anything but a conventional send-off. From its high-octane visuals to Anirudh Ravichander's pulsating background score titled The True Leader Theme, every element teases a grand, emotionally-charged cinematic event. Venkat also acknowledged the creative vision of director H. Vinoth and the musical genius of Anirudh, both of whom are bringing their distinct energies to elevate the scale of the project. 'The 'First Roar' is just a glimpse into the cinematic and emotional scale of what we're building," Narayana reiterated in his statement. With the first look out, anticipation for Jana Nayagan has skyrocketed. And if this early glimpse is anything to go by, Thalapathy Vijay's final bow is set to roar louder than ever before.
